      <description>Location: Glasgow | Salary: Negotiable | Type: Permanent | Scottish Renewables is seeking a strategic and influential policy leader to drive its onshore renewables agenda at a pivotal moment for Scotland''s energy transition.  As Head of Onshore Policy, you will lead the organisation''s work on the issues that matter most to the successful deployment of onshore renewable energy, particularly onshore wind. Working at the heart of industry, government and regulation, you will influence policy, build consensus across a diverse membership and help remove barriers to project delivery. The role places a particular emphasis on planning and consenting, whilst also engaging with wider issues including grid infrastructure, transport logistics and other challenges impacting renewable energy development.
